September is during the rainy season. Not that there will be hard torrential rains but it is constant and annoying. Still, everything else is "business as usual" as far as nightclubs...which is all I can tell you about since I do not surf.

Knowing Portuguese would be a big plus but AT LEAST take with you a phrase book so you can engage in limited conversation. Actually, if you study/prep yourself using a decent phrase book starting now, you should be OK about the time September rolls around.

Note: Make sure you get a BRAZILIAN Portuguese book. Don't get the "continental" Portuguese book (which is the European version) and use it in Brazil as only 60-70% only translates. You will end up like my very first visit to Brazil....reciting exactly out of a continental Portuguese book and the Brazilians look at you like "HUH?"....lol
